Lanbhiya is a Rural village located in Bodeli, Chhotaudepur, Gujarat.
The total population of Lanbhiya is 242.
Lanbhiya village comprises 44 households.
The literacy rate in Lanbhiya is 42.5%. Among the literate population of 88, there are 61 literate males and 27 literate females.
In Lanbhiya, there are 134 males and 108 females, with a sex ratio of 806 females per 1000 males.
There are 35 children (14.5% of population), comprising 22 boys and 13 girls.
The total number of workers in Lanbhiya is 99, with 98 main workers and 1 marginal workers.
In Lanbhiya, there are 0 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(0 males, 0 females) and 177 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(100 males, 77 females).
Lanbhiya is located in Gujarat state, Chhotaudepur district, and falls under Bodeli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 520735 and LGD code is 520735.
